Insights and research on health and tech.
Find out more
North Staffordshire Combined Healthcare NHS Trust
By Catherine Barras
University Hospitals of Morecambe Bay NHS Foundation Trust’s
Royal Papworth Hospital NHS Foundation Trust
Please open in latest version of Chrome, Firefox, Safari browser for best experience or update your browser.